The LG G8 ThinQ is way better than Huawei Honor 5X, having a global score of 84.3 against 63.8. Even though LG G8 ThinQ is noticeably newer than Huawei Honor 5X, it's just a little thicker and just a little bit heavier. Both phones we are comparing here work with Android OS (operating system), but LG G8 ThinQ has a newer 9.0 Pie version and Huawei Honor 5X has Android 5.1, so it counts with some nice extra features and better performance.
LG G8 ThinQ has a bit more vivid screen than Huawei Honor 5X, because it has a lot higher 1440 x 3120 resolution, a quite bigger screen and a better screen pixel density. The LG G8 ThinQ has a superior memory for applications and games than Huawei Honor 5X, because it has 128 GB internal storage capacity and an external memory card slot that admits a maximum of 1,95 TB.
The LG G8 ThinQ has an extremely better processing unit than Huawei Honor 5X, because it has a larger number of faster cores and 3 GB more RAM memory. LG G8 ThinQ shoots way better videos and photos than Huawei Honor 5X, because although it has a less mega pixels back facing camera, it also counts with a way bigger diafragm aperture for better images and video in low light environments.
LG G8 ThinQ has just a bit better battery lifetime than Huawei Honor 5X, because it has a 3500mAh battery capacity.
LG G8 ThinQ costs a bit more than Huawei Honor 5X, but you can get a much better phone for that extra dollars.
